Avoid failure by validating your AEC software early. Nearly 29% of startups fail due to running out of funds before achieving product-market fit. A clear validation process ensures your software aligns with industry needs, integrates smoothly into workflows, and minimizes risks.
Key Takeaways:
- Why Validate? To reduce risks, optimize resources, and confirm market relevance.
- Market Insights: The AEC software market will grow from $9.06 billion in 2023 to $22.85 billion by 2033, driven by trends like digital transformation and sustainability.
- User Needs: Architects, engineers, and construction professionals need tools tailored to design, compliance, and project management.
- Validation Steps: Conduct user research, prioritize features, build an MVP, and test with pilot programs.
- Metrics to Watch: Retention rates, NPS, market fit, and feature usage guide improvements.
Start small, listen to users, and iterate based on feedback. Focus on solving real problems to create software that stands out in the growing AEC market.
From Idea to MVP: How to Validate Your Tech Startup
AEC Market Analysis
The AEC software market is projected to grow significantly, rising from $9.06 billion in 2023 to $22.85 billion by 2033 [4]. This growth highlights the increasing demand for solutions that meet evolving user expectations.
Key User Groups and Their Needs
The AEC industry includes several professional groups, each with distinct software requirements:
- Architects: Need tools for design, BIM integration, and collaboration. They face challenges like tight budgets, regulatory compliance, and environmentally conscious design.
- Engineers: Require simulation tools, AI-driven analysis, and safety compliance features. They deal with labor shortages, fast-changing technology, and inefficiencies in workflows.
- Construction Professionals: Look for project management software, resource tracking, and safety management systems. Common issues include resource mismanagement, project delays, and workforce gaps.
A survey found that 55% of architects and engineers report staffing shortages [3]. This underscores the importance of software that prioritizes usability and efficiency.
Market Trends and Standards
North America leads the AEC software market, accounting for 42.6% of the global share [4]. The most-used applications are design tools (47%) and preconstruction planning software (44.9%). Despite the rise of cloud solutions, on-premises software still dominates with a 66.6% market share [4].
Several key trends are shaping the industry:
- Digital Transformation: Tools like digital twins and 3D modeling are enabling real-time collaboration and helping predict potential issues [2].
- Sustainability: With the construction sector generating 100 billion tons of waste annually, software must address the push for environmentally friendly building practices [3].
- Cloud and AI: Cloud-based connectivity and AI-driven analytics are automating design processes and improving performance forecasting [4].
Understanding these trends and market dynamics is essential for creating software that meets industry needs while adhering to regulatory and professional standards. These insights can help focus development on features that truly resonate with users.
Core Feature Planning
User Research Methods
Talk to architects, engineers, and construction managers to understand which features matter most.
"You only need to speak to 5 users to determine all of your product’s problems." – Jakob Nielsen [6]
Tailor your interview questions to match the product stage. Early on, focus on understanding core needs. During development, ask about prototypes. After release, dig into how the product is used in practice. Combine these interviews with surveys, analytics, and support tickets to get a full picture [1]. Use this data to build detailed user personas and map out their workflows.
User Personas and Workflows
For each persona, outline their background, job responsibilities, technology preferences, and how they collaborate with others. Mapping out their daily workflows can help you spot key moments where your software can make the biggest impact.
Feature Selection and Ranking
Once you’ve nailed down personas and workflows, it’s time to pick and rank features for a focused MVP.
Here’s a straightforward way to prioritize features:
- Evaluate each feature based on its value to users, business potential, and how realistic it is to build.
- Categorize features as must-have, should-have, or nice-to-have.
- Start with the must-haves in your phased MVP plan [1].
"Your MVP won’t work if your customers can’t see any value. Build what customers want and then scale." – Joe Procopio, Product Expert & Startup Founder [5]
Use the 5 Whys method to ensure every feature addresses a core problem [6].
sbb-itb-51b9a02
MVP Development and Testing
Once you’ve prioritized features, it’s time to bring your MVP to life using quick prototyping, iterative testing, and focused refinements.
Prototype Creation
- Identify the primary challenge your MVP addresses and determine the essential features it needs to solve that challenge [1].
- Use two-week sprints to develop these core features, incorporating early feedback as you go [1].
User Testing Process
When your prototype is ready, structured testing is essential to gather insights into usability and performance:
-
Pilot Phases
Conduct unit tests, integration tests, performance tests, and finally, user acceptance testing [1]. -
Testing and Analytics
Gather qualitative feedback through in-app surveys and user interviews. Use analytics and A/B testing to track how features are used and measure task success rates [7].
MVP Updates and Improvements
For each iteration, follow these steps:
- Review feedback from surveys, interviews, analytics, and support channels.
- Determine which updates to prioritize based on their user impact, value, and feasibility.
- Roll out changes in small, incremental releases.
- Test these updates with your user group to confirm their effectiveness [1].
Finally, assess your MVP’s market fit by running pilot programs, analyzing user feedback, and reviewing performance metrics.
Market Fit Assessment
Once your MVP is polished, the next step is to evaluate its market fit through targeted pilot programs.
Pilot Program Implementation
Start small by launching with 1–2 smaller firms. Once you’ve gathered initial insights, expand to mid-size and enterprise-level organizations. This phased approach helps identify potential scalability issues early on, allowing you to address them before a broader rollout.
User Feedback Analysis
Gather both quantitative and qualitative feedback using tools like in-app surveys, user interviews, usage analytics, and support logs. Focus on updates that offer the highest impact for users, deliver a strong ROI, and are feasible to implement.
Performance Metrics
Monitor a mix of key metrics to evaluate success, including:
- Sales volume
- Total addressable market
- Retention rate
- Net Promoter Score (NPS)
- Customer lifetime value (CLV)
- Customer acquisition cost (CAC)
- Referrals
Additionally, track how users engage with specific features and analyze trends in usage. These insights will shape your iterations and inform your go-to-market strategies.
Conclusion: Steps for Successful AEC Software Validation
Validating AEC software requires a structured approach, aligning each phase with market demands and user feedback. This process minimizes risks and avoids unnecessary waste. Here’s how you can take your software from concept to a validated product:
- Market Research: Analyze the industry, conduct user interviews, and benchmark competitors to identify market size and key challenges.
- MVP Definition: Focus on core features and refine your value proposition to create a prioritized feature set.
- Development: Use agile sprints, perform QA, and ensure compliance testing to measure sprint progress and fix issues efficiently.
- Pilot Testing: Deploy on a small scale, gather feedback, and track user adoption and feature usage.
- Refinement: Make data-driven improvements and plan for scalability, focusing on satisfaction and performance metrics.
With nearly 29% of startups running out of funds before achieving product-market fit [1], validating assumptions early is critical. Treat validation as a continuous process – use tools like in-app surveys, interviews, analytics, and support logs to gather insights and iterate.
When prioritizing updates, focus on these three factors [1]:
- User Impact: How the change affects users’ workflows.
- Business Value: The return on investment it could generate.
- Implementation Feasibility: The resources and technical effort required.
These steps build on earlier discussions of user research, prototyping, and market fit assessments, ensuring your AEC software addresses industry needs while reducing risks and optimizing resources.
Leave a Reply